What Is Ondo Finance?
Ondo Finance develops platforms, assets, and infrastructure designed to bring traditional financial markets onchain. Its ecosystem includes products connected to assets such as short-term United States government securities, money-market funds, and publicly traded securities.
For example, OUSG is designed to provide eligible qualified
purchasers with exposure to short-term US Treasuries and money-market funds.
Ondo states that its primary assets include the BlackRock USD Institutional
Digital Liquidity Fund, subject to applicable product terms and eligibility
requirements.
USDY is a separate product with specific legal,
jurisdictional, and transfer restrictions. Ondo’s official materials state that
USDY has not been registered under the US Securities Act of 1933 and is subject
to restrictions in the United States and other jurisdictions.
These products should not be confused with the ONDO token
itself.
What Is the ONDO
Token?
ONDO is principally a governance token associated with the
Ondo DAO. According to the Ondo Foundation, ONDO holders can participate in
decisions involving Flux Finance, including supported markets, interest-rate
models, oracle addresses, protocol administration, treasury management, and
token emissions.
Holding ONDO does not automatically mean that a person owns
the Treasury securities, money-market assets, or other collateral associated
with separate Ondo products. ONDO, OUSG, USDY, and tokenized securities within
the wider ecosystem have distinct structures and functions.
That distinction is essential in any credible comparison. A
governance token cannot be evaluated as though it were the same instrument as a
reserve-backed or asset-referenced token.

What Is a Diamond-Backed Token?
A diamond-backed token is generally described as a
blockchain-based digital instrument connected to physical diamonds held within
a defined custody or reserve framework. The exact legal and economic meaning
depends on the token’s documentation.
A token might represent a direct claim on identified
diamonds, a contractual entitlement, access to a platform function, a
fractional interest, or another defined relationship. The phrase
“diamond-backed” does not establish those rights by itself.
VittaGems has published educational material describing
diamond-backed tokens and its intended role in precious-asset tokenization.
However, readers should examine final legal terms, reserve reports, custody
records, redemption conditions, eligibility rules, and technical documentation
before drawing conclusions about any upcoming token.
This is why token classifications must remain precise.
Governance, utility, asset reference, custody rights, and redemption rights
should be examined independently.

Financial securities can often reference established market
prices, regulated intermediaries, and standardized settlement systems. Diamonds
require controls for grading, provenance, storage, insurance, valuation,
identification, and liquidity.
Diamonds are not completely uniform assets. Their value can
vary according to weight, cut, color, clarity, certification, origin,
condition, and prevailing market demand.
A credible Diamond
Token framework therefore needs more than a total reserve value. It should
explain:
·
Which diamonds are held
·
How they are identified
·
Which grading standards apply
·
Who provides custody
·
How frequently valuations are updated
·
How insurance and loss events are handled
·
Whether tokens can be redeemed
· How reserve assets are separated from company assets
Without this information, users cannot accurately evaluate
the relationship between the token supply and the physical reserve.
A Multi-Asset Token can connect digital infrastructure to
several asset categories rather than one underlying resource. This may support
broader treasury or settlement use cases, but it also creates additional
verification responsibilities.
The issuer must explain how each asset category is valued,
weighted, held, audited, and reconciled. Readers should also determine whether
each token is supported by a pooled reserve or linked to specifically
identified assets.
A multi-asset structure should not be assumed to reduce risk
automatically. Its credibility depends on reserve quality, custody, legal
enforceability, operational controls, and transparent reporting.
Web3 can provide a shared transaction layer for asset
records, transfers, permissions, smart contracts, and programmable workflows.
It does not independently verify that a physical asset exists or that a legal
claim is enforceable.
Blockchain records can show that a token was issued or transferred. They cannot, without reliable offchain evidence, prove:
·
That a particular diamond is held in custody
·
That its grading report is authentic
·
That the reserve is free from conflicting claims
·
That a token holder has enforceable redemption
rights
·
That an operator follows AML and KYC
requirements
Web3 infrastructure is most useful when onchain transparency
is combined with reliable offchain verification.
Are Diamond Tokens
NFTs?
An NFT may be appropriate when one token corresponds to one
individually identified diamond, grading report, custody record, or digital
certificate. A fungible token may be more appropriate when units reference a
pooled reserve under standardized terms.
The technical standard does not determine the legal rights.
An NFT linked to a diamond does not necessarily transfer ownership of that
diamond unless the applicable contract and custody structure explicitly
establish that result.
What Users and
Businesses Should Check
Verification is the most important part of any asset-backed
token comparison.
Users should identify the company issuing the token, the
entity operating the platform, and the entity holding the reserve assets. These
may be different organizations.
Official corporate information, registered addresses,
directors, governing law, and contractual responsibilities should be available
and internally consistent.
Asset-backed and financial-token platforms may need to apply AML, KYC, sanctions screening, geographic restrictions, and investor or customer eligibility controls.
Ondo documents eligibility and onboarding requirements for
products such as OUSG and states that legal and regulatory compliance is a
central part of its tokenized-asset framework.
VittaGems users should similarly review which services
require identity verification, which jurisdictions are supported, who is
eligible to hold or use a token, and whether transfers or redemptions are
restricted.
For diamond-backed
tokens, verification should extend to:
·
Independent grading documentation
·
Unique asset identifiers
·
Vault or custodian records
·
Insurance coverage
·
Chain-of-custody information
·
Reconciliation between assets and token supply
·
Procedures for damaged, missing, or disputed
assets
A reserve statement produced only by the token operator
provides less assurance than evidence involving independent custodians,
graders, accountants, or assurance providers.
Readers should
distinguish among several forms of review:
A financial audit examines financial records. A reserve
attestation examines assets at a specific time or over a defined period. A
smart-contract audit examines software. A legal opinion evaluates a particular
legal question.
Ondo publishes trust, security, and audit information for
parts of its ecosystem. Any VittaGems gold token launch should likewise be evaluated
through current contract audits, reserve reporting, custody evidence, legal
terms, and disclosure of administrative controls.
A credible reserve
framework should answer four questions:
·
What assets are included?
·
Who owns and controls them?
·
How are they valued and reconciled?
· What rights does the token holder receive?
Reserve value alone is not enough. Users should understand
whether there is a direct asset claim, a contractual entitlement, a
service-based function, or no redemption right at all.
Users should rely on official websites, current terms,
verified contract addresses, legal documentation, audit reports, and authenticated
company communications.
Marketing pages and social-media posts may help explain a project, but they should not replace governing documents.

How VGMG Fits Into the VittaGems Ecosystem
VGMG should be distinguished from any gold-, silver-, diamond-, or multi-asset-backed token offered through the VittaGems ecosystem.
VittaGems describes VGMG as a utility token intended to
support eligible platform access, service-related transactions, operational
workflows, and selected ecosystem functions. Availability is subject to
applicable terms, law, jurisdiction, eligibility, and technical readiness.
Depending on the
final platform framework, defined utility may include eligible functions such
as:
·
Accessing supported ecosystem services
·
Participating in approved platform workflows
·
Paying for designated service functions
·
Supporting settlement-related processes
·
Using selected transaction or operational
features
Planned functions should always be labeled as planned until
they are operational and documented.
VGMG should not be
described as:
·
Equity or ownership in VittaGems
·
A security or company share
·
A passive-income product
·
A guaranteed-return instrument
·
A right to token-price appreciation
·
An automatic ownership claim over diamonds
·
A promise of profit or yield
Its value proposition should be evaluated through actual
platform utility, eligibility, documentation, security, and operational use—not
speculative expectations.

Is ONDO backed by US
Treasuries?
ONDO itself is primarily a governance token and should not
be treated as a direct claim on the assets supporting separate Ondo products.
Products such as OUSG have their own structures, assets, eligibility rules, and
legal documentation.
What backs a
VittaGems Diamond Token?
The answer must come from the final token documentation.
Users should verify identified diamonds, grading records, custody, insurance,
valuation methods, reserve reconciliation, and any redemption rights before relying
on an asset-backing claim.
Is VGMG the same as a
diamond-backed token?
No. VGMG is described as a utility token for defined
VittaGems ecosystem functions. It should not automatically be treated as a
direct claim on diamonds or other reserve assets.
Can diamond-backed
tokens be NFTs?
Yes. An NFT can be used to identify a unique diamond or
certificate. A diamond-backed system can also use fungible tokens connected to
a pooled reserve. The token format does not, by itself, establish ownership or
redemption rights.
What should
businesses verify before using an asset-backed token?
Businesses should verify the issuer, legal structure,
custody arrangements, asset records, reserve logic, AML/KYC controls,
jurisdictional eligibility, smart-contract audits, redemption process,
liquidity arrangements, and official contract addresses.
